Mini toy sci-fi spaceship separated into easily printable pieces, enabling the opportunity to customise the colour scheme. Great for those looking for a non-franchised and non-weaponised space themed toy. This is the smaller sized version of the ship, and printable in any of three variants: with side text, without side text, or lastly text free but with side intakes. Take your pick! ● Easy to print parts - no supports required

● Designed with colour breaks. Print parts in different colours on single colour printers for a more interesting look.

● Requires multiple #4 x 3/8" pan head screws (or 4G x 9mm sheet metal screws)

● A Phillips head #1 screwdriver is also needed. Very helpful (though not always necessary) is a hobby knife, a selection of small files, and/or some sandpaper.

The part orientation as per upload is correct. Some parts require a little bridging while printing, though still print well enough without support. Interconnecting part fit may be tight, depending on the plastics used, or the printer/slicer settings. Some careful sanding or filing, or even reducing/enlarging the part size slightly during printing can help with assembly.

Three #4 x 3/8" or 4G x 9mm sheet metal screws are used to join parts throughout the model. One screw remains visible in the thruster once the ship is complete. Colouring it in with a red permanent marker helps a little with visual appeal. With correctly sized parts, no glue is necessary. Lastly, and in general, I get great results printing on rafts.
